当前位置: 首页
AI
千问AI如何自动生成API文档提升后端开发效率

千问AI如何自动生成API文档提升后端开发效率

热心网友 时间:2026-05-18
转载
千问AI能够有效辅助生成高质量的API文档,主要涵盖四个核心应用场景:一、基于代码注释智能生成符合OpenAPI规范的文档初稿;二、将Swagger/OpenAPI契约文件转化为易于理解的中文技术文档,并补充业务逻辑说明;三、同步生成配套的接口测试用例与文档调用示例;四、依据接口变更点自动生成结构化的版本历史记录。

千问ai能帮我做api文档吗?后端开发提效【后端】

希望借助千问AI快速完成API文档编写,从而提升后端开发的工作效率?这个方向是正确的,但关键在于清晰了解其能力边界、适用场景以及高效操作的具体步骤。以下是一套经过实践验证的、可落地的完整工作流程。

一、基于代码注释自动生成文档草稿

千问AI擅长处理结构化信息。开发者可以将包含函数签名、参数定义、返回值类型及现有注释的代码片段提供给它,AI能够据此生成一份结构清晰、符合规范的Markdown或纯文本格式的文档初稿。需要明确的是,最终输出文档的质量,高度依赖于输入信息的准确性与规范性。

具体操作可分为三个步骤:首先,将后端接口的源代码片段——包括关键的函数名、入参列表、出参结构以及核心业务逻辑简述——完整粘贴至千问AI的对话界面。接着,输入明确的指令,例如:“请根据以下Go/Java/Python代码,生成符合OpenAPI 3.0规范的API文档描述,需包含接口路径、HTTP方法、请求头示例、请求体JSON结构、成功响应示例及标准错误码说明。”最后,也是至关重要的一步:对AI生成的结果,特别是涉及字段数据类型、HTTP状态码、参数必填/选填等关键信息,必须进行严格的人工审核与修正。

二、依据接口契约(如Swagger JSON/YAML)优化文档表述

如果项目已存在基础的Swagger或OpenAPI定义文件,千问AI可以扮演“技术翻译”与“内容补充”的角色。它能够将机器可读但表述较为生硬的契约描述,转化为对前端工程师、测试人员更友好的自然语言,并补充必要的业务背景与上下文信息。

操作方法同样直接:复制现有swagger.jsonopenapi.yaml文件中特定接口路径的定义内容。随后向千问AI发出指令:“请将以下OpenAPI路径定义改写为流畅的中文技术文档段落,要求包含:接口核心功能、调用方所需权限、典型业务使用场景、重要注意事项。”在审阅AI生成的文本时,需要重点确认关键的业务约束是否被准确传达,例如权限要求是否与项目实际的RBAC(基于角色的访问控制)策略保持一致,或者注意事项中是否明确标注了接口超时阈值和推荐的重试机制

三、批量生成接口测试用例与文档联动条目

保持API文档与测试用例的同步更新是一项常见挑战。千问AI在此环节能提供有效支持。通过输入接口的功能性描述,它可以同步产出对应的测试用例脚本以及文档中的“调用示例”章节内容。

例如,你可以提供如下输入:“用户查询订单列表接口,支持按订单状态进行过滤,分页大小固定为每页20条记录,请求需携带有效的X-Auth-Token认证头。”接着请求AI输出:“请生成对应的curl命令示例、Postman环境变量引用格式、三种常见订单状态参数的合法取值说明,以及该接口在API文档‘请求示例’部分的完整段落。”获得结果后,务必仔细核对细节:确保AI返回的curl命令中,类似 -H ‘X-Auth-Token: ${token}’ 的环境变量占位符格式被正确保留,避免被误替换为具体的测试值,从而保证示例的通用性和指导意义。

四、维护文档版本变更日志

随着接口迭代,API文档需要持续更新。手动维护变更日志耗时费力,千问AI可以帮助自动化此过程。它能根据代码差异对比或Pull Request的描述,自动提炼API的变更影响范围,并撰写格式规范的版本更新说明。

标准操作流程如下:首先,整理本次迭代涉及的修改要点清单,例如新增或废弃的接口路径、请求/响应字段的增删改、HTTP状态码的调整等。然后将其提交给千问AI:“请根据以下变更点,编写适用于API文档‘版本历史’章节的条目,格式要求为:[YYYY-MM-DD] + 变更类型(新增/修改/废弃)+ 接口路径 + 简要的影响说明。”最终的确认环节必不可少:必须逐项核对AI输出中所有的接口路径是否与线上部署的路由完全一致(包括版本前缀如 /v2/),防止出现遗留的/v1/等陈旧路径引用,导致文档与实际接口脱节。

来源:https://www.php.cn/faq/2357576.html

游乐网为非赢利性网站,所展示的游戏/软件/文章内容均来自于互联网或第三方用户上传分享,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系youleyoucom@outlook.com。

同类文章
更多
Firefox浏览器Xdebug调试扩展安装与使用指南

Firefox浏览器Xdebug调试扩展安装与使用指南

对于PHP开发者来说,Xdebug是进行代码调试的得力助手。但在进行远程调试时,手动在URL后添加“XDEBUG_SESSION_START”这类参数,操作起来既繁琐又容易出错。有没有更优雅的解决方案? 答案是肯定的。由知名开发者Derick Rethans(同时也是Xdebug项目的领导者)推出的

时间:2026-05-18 19:08
2026年国外手机AI工具排行榜前十名盘点

2026年国外手机AI工具排行榜前十名盘点

2026年的手机AI工具市场,早已不是简单的语音助手或聊天机器人。它们正深度融入工作流,成为跨应用、跨场景的智能中枢。根据近期全球主流测评机构的数据、开发者社区的调用量统计以及真实用户反馈,我们梳理出当前海外市场最具代表性的十款手机AI工具。它们覆盖了从语音处理、内容生成到图像理解与智能协作等核心能

时间:2026-05-18 19:08
龙虾OpenClaw开启支付宝声纹支付设置步骤详解

龙虾OpenClaw开启支付宝声纹支付设置步骤详解

想在龙虾OpenClaw上体验“动动嘴就完成支付”的便捷声纹支付功能?这项技术确实高效,但需要确保几个核心环节均已正确配置。如果您的智能体已部署,却无法使用声纹支付,问题通常集中在几个方面:声纹识别模块未激活、相关权限配置不足,或支付宝账户的生物认证绑定尚未完成。 无需担心,按照以下步骤清单逐一排查

时间:2026-05-18 19:05
支付宝AI付离线安装教程 手动配置龙虾openclaw指南

支付宝AI付离线安装教程 手动配置龙虾openclaw指南

需通过离线安装包与手动配置实现OpenClaw本地支付宝AI付集成:一查安装包完整性;二部署私钥与证书;三注入技能模块;四设环境变量启用;五验证技能可用性。 在离线环境下为OpenClaw(龙虾)集成支付宝AI付功能,确实需要一些手动操作的功夫。整个过程环环相扣,任何一个环节的疏漏都可能导致集成失败

时间:2026-05-18 19:04
支付宝AI付深度配置与支付环境优化指南

支付宝AI付深度配置与支付环境优化指南

想要让OpenClaw(龙虾AI)与支付宝AI付实现深度集成,构建一个高性能、高安全性的支付环境,仅仅完成基础的开通设置是远远不够的。你需要进入系统级权限配置、沙箱环境调优以及支付链路冗余加固的“硬核”优化阶段。以下五个核心步骤,将为你提供一套完整的操作指南,以彻底解锁支付宝AI付的全部潜力。 一、

时间:2026-05-18 19:04
热门专题
更多
刀塔传奇破解版无限钻石下载大全 刀塔传奇破解版无限钻石下载大全
洛克王国正式正版手游下载安装大全 洛克王国正式正版手游下载安装大全
思美人手游下载专区 思美人手游下载专区
好玩的阿拉德之怒游戏下载合集 好玩的阿拉德之怒游戏下载合集
不思议迷宫手游下载合集 不思议迷宫手游下载合集
百宝袋汉化组游戏最新合集 百宝袋汉化组游戏最新合集
jsk游戏合集30款游戏大全 jsk游戏合集30款游戏大全
宾果消消消原版下载大全 宾果消消消原版下载大全
  • 日榜
  • 周榜
  • 月榜
热门教程
更多
  • 游戏攻略
  • 安卓教程
  • 苹果教程
  • 电脑教程